Removal and Installation
Old system removal starts with safe disconnection—electric systems require electrical isolation, gas systems need gas line capping, solar systems require collector removal. We disconnect plumbing, remove the old tank, and dispose of it in compliance with Gold Coast council regulations. The site is then prepared for new equipment installation.
Aquatech heat pump installation involves positioning the outdoor unit to meet noise and setback requirements confirmed during site assessment, placing the indoor tank where it connects efficiently to existing plumbing, and running all pipework between outdoor and indoor components. For split-level homes, we route pipes through the most direct path between levels.
Plumbing connections include all supply and return pipework, pressure testing to confirm no leaks, and tempering valve installation to Australian Standards ensuring safe outlet temperatures. Electrical connections by licensed electricians (included in the fixed price) ensure the outdoor unit and controls operate correctly, meeting Gold Coast building codes.
Compliance and Rebates
All installations meet Queensland Plumbing and Wastewater Code requirements, with tempering valves installed to deliver safe 50°C outlet temperatures regardless of tank temperature. We confirm outdoor unit placement meets Gold Coast Council noise and setback requirements, particularly important on Ormeau Hills' larger blocks where boundary distances vary.
Queensland government heat pump rebates offer up to $1,000 for eligible households replacing electric or gas systems. We complete all rebate paperwork on your behalf as part of the $3,600 installation price, assessing eligibility during your quote and handling the entire application process. Noise and Setback Rules
Noise compliance matters more on Ormeau Hills' quieter blocks compared to high-density suburbs. Modern Aquatech heat pumps operate at 40-50 decibels (similar to quiet conversation), but we still position them to minimise impact on bedrooms and outdoor living areas. This typically means placing outdoor units away from bedroom windows and entertaining zones.
Gold Coast Council setback requirements and estate covenants usually specify minimum distances from boundaries—we position outdoor units to meet these rules while maintaining plumbing efficiency. Split-level homes may require outdoor unit placement at a different level to the indoor tank, affecting installation complexity but still achievable with experienced installers.
Why Heat Pumps Suit Ormeau Hills Homes
Gold Coast's subtropical climate with 300+ sunny days annually makes heat pumps up to 3× more efficient than electric resistance systems. Heat pumps extract thermal energy from ambient air, requiring only electricity to run the compressor and fan rather than directly heating water with resistance elements. This efficiency advantage is maximised in Gold Coast's consistently warm climate.
Larger family homes in Ormeau Hills have higher hot water usage than smaller properties—typically 200-300 litres daily for families compared to 100-150 litres for couples. This amplifies the energy savings from heat pump efficiency: a family using 250 litres daily will see significantly larger electricity bill reductions than a couple using 100 litres, making the investment in heat pump technology more financially beneficial.
Ormeau Hills properties often have higher power bills due to home size, air conditioning usage, and larger households. Switching from electric hot water (one of the largest residential energy consumers) to a heat pump system that uses one-third the electricity delivers substantial bill reductions. The Northern Suburbs' newer homes also tend to have larger tank requirements—heat pumps scale efficiently to 250-315 litre tanks common in family homes.
Modern building standards in newer Ormeau Hills estates favour energy-efficient hot water solutions like heat pumps, particularly in homes targeting higher energy ratings. Heat pumps contribute to overall home energy performance, aligning with contemporary building practices in the Northern Suburbs growth corridor.
The Northern Suburbs climate features mild winters where outdoor units maintain efficiency year-round. Unlike southern states where heat pump efficiency drops in freezing temperatures, Gold Coast's winter minimums rarely affect heat pump performance—the systems operate at near-peak efficiency across all seasons.
